Senior Pipeline Project Engineer - Calgary, Canada - Randstad Canada
Description
We are currently seeking a Pipeline Project Engineer who has proven knowledge and experience in the development and design of capital pipeline projects for Natural Gas Compression projects, Auxiliary Equipment and Facilities.
Support the planning, design, and provide technical assurance of Pipelines.The ideal candidate will also have knowledge in pipeline construction.
While reporting to the Project Engineering Manager, the person selected for this role will be collaborating with the Project Management team to support project development activities, including but not limited to due diligence, permitting, technical advisory services and project management to support early stages of investment planning, through project development.
What you'll doProvide Pipeline engineering technical direction and support for the design of multiple Gas Pipelines
Ensure that project designs are fit-for-purpose and demonstrated to meet project development expectations (such as performance and cost) as well as technical, regulatory, environmental, commercial, safety, operating, and maintenance requirements
Follow companies Practice of Engineering, design, and construction specifications and standards
Work with the project team to select and onboard the providers for Detailed Design work, and then monitor and provide oversight of the engineering contractor (who is accountable for detailed design)
Work closely with Development team to successfully meet quality assurance on time and on budget
Technical support for fabrication, construction and commissioning
Technical leadership, coaching, and mentoring of junior staff
Implement short-term and long-term solutions for mechanical integrity issues for new Pipelines and for operations
Manage relationship with consultants and SME's (Subject Matter Experts) from various disciplines and other stakeholders
Liaison with the project team and support groups including, Engineering, Land, Environment, Procurement, Operations, to facilitate engineering management during construction and commissioning including management of RFIs (Management of Design Changes)
Assist with the review and evaluation of scope changes during construction
Technically support resolution of Non-Conformances generated during construction and commissioning
Review hydrostatic testing documentation
Manage the engineering workflow between construction teams and project teams
Provide engineering solutions that lead to effective monitoring, assessment and management of construction hazards on pipeline assets, with consideration given for the safety and quality of the solution and life cycle costs for the program
This position is viewed as the Company Engineering representative through the overall project cycles with high technical knowledge and experience.
Bachelor's degree Engineering (Civil, Mechanical, or other Pipeline Engineering related discipline)
P.Eng. designation and eligible for registration with APEGA or an equivalent governing body in Canada (Registered and in good standing)
Linear pipeline project experience, preferably with large diameter pipelines
Min. of 10 years of experience with a combination of Pipeline Engineering design and/or experience in the field (preferably majority of the experience is in the pipeline construction)
Knowledge in drilling techniques in Canada for open cut/trenchless crossing
Preferred Qualifications
Strong understanding of the engineering design process, including cross-discipline knowledge
Knowledge of existing company infrastructure and familiarity with management systems and project delivery standards,
Experience with small and large diameter pipelines
Previously demonstrated dedication to safety
Ability and initiative to work independently, display creativity, and exercise sound judgement
Demonstrated superior organizational skills and proven ability to manage projects within scope and budget
Skills to effectively operate in a team-oriented environment with a willingness to support team objectives
Excellent verbal and written communication skills to work closely with field teams, management, third party resources, and coordinate work with other appropriate technical resources
Computer skills are required (Excel, Power Point, among others) to record findings, records tracking, and presentation.
There will be occasional travel to different sites as required to support Engineering design.
